			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/interface/20090211aCamp.jpg" title="A Camp" class="leftImgWithCredit" /><span class="leftCredit"><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/icon_cam.gif" class="cam" alt="Photo via mySpace" /><a href="http://www.myspace.com/acamptheband" target="new" title="MySpace">MySpace</a></span>The first <a href="Http://www.acamp.net" Target="new" title="A CAmp">A Camp</a> album came at an interesting time, with <a href="Http://www.cardigans.com" target="new" title="Cardigans">The Cardigans</a> having proven themselves not just a one-hit wonder but a two-hit one (&#8220;My Favourite Game&#8221; to go along with &#8220;Lovefool&#8221;) but also rather burning out in the process.  Nina Persson used the downtime to explore country music and Americana with the assistance of <a href="Http://www.sparklehorse.com" target="new" title="sparklehorse">Sparklehorse&#8217;s</a> Mark Linkous and not only crafted an excellent record in their self-titled debut, but carried the influences back to The Cardigans to inform my personal favourite of their repertoire, <a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Long-Gone-Before-Daylight-Cardigans/dp/B00020HALU/ref=pd_bbs_sr_4?ie=UTF8&#038;s=music&#038;qid=1234316288&#038;sr=8-4" target="new" title="Long Gone Before Daylight"><i>Long Gone Before Daylight</i></a>.  That stylistic uniformity went out the window with their next record, the eclectic but still very solid <a href="http://www.amazon.ca/Super-Extra-Gravity-Cardigans/dp/B000B8I99K/ref=sr_1_3?ie=UTF8&#038;s=music&#038;qid=1234316359&#038;sr=1-3" target="new" title="Super Extra Gravity"><i>Super Extra Gravity</i></a> and with the Cardies again on a break, Persson has taken that grab-bag aesthetic back to A Camp.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.cdwow.us/A-CAMP-Colonia/product/view/3874037" target="new" title="Colonia"><i>Colonia</i></a>, released in Europe last week but not out in North America until April 28, collects 11 songs that could have been Cardigans tunes in another life but could never be mistaken as such in the forms that they&#8217;ve been recorded in here.  With the formal addition of Persson&#8217;s husband Nathan Larson (of <a href="http://www.shuddertothink.com/" target="new" title="STT">Shudder To Think</a>) and Niclas Frisk as members of A Camp, it&#8217;s now more of an official band than before but rather than imprint that band with a particular sonic identity, they instead reinvent themselves in whatever way necessary to compliment the songs.  Persson&#8217;s vocals are unmistakable but the sounds that surround it incorporate elements of show tunes, electronica, glam and country to name just a very few &#8211; there&#8217;s enough of everything to make it sound familiar but never to the point of being able to place a song in a tidy pigeonhole.</p>
<p>If there&#8217;s a common thread, it&#8217;s the sonic richness and elegance each song is imbued with.  No matter what they put in it, it <i>sounds</i> marvelous, even if some songs are less memorable than others.  But the keepers are worth cherishing &#8211; &#8220;My America&#8221; is buoyed by jaunty horns, the languidness of &#8220;Chinatown&#8221; beautifully channels <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Television_(band)" target="new" title="Television">Television</a> in its guitar lines and lead single &#8220;Stronger Than Jesus&#8221; boasts a melody that&#8217;s as indelible as anything Persson&#8217;s ever come up with.  Though I wish as much as any fan that the Cardies break will be a short one &#8211; apparently Persson&#8217;s bandmates are all using the time to tend to fatherly duties &#8211; if it continues to yield more A Camp records then there&#8217;ll be no word of complaint from me.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/interface/20090201morningBenders.jpg" title="The Morning Benders" class="leftImgWithCredit" /><span class="leftCredit150"><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/icon_cam.gif" class="cam" alt="Photo via Gigantic" /><a href="http://ambenders.blogspot.com/2008/07/bedroom-covers.html" target="new" title="gigantic">Gigantic</a></span>Let it never be said that NoCal&#8217;s <a href="http://www.themorningbenders.com/" target="new" title="Morning Benders">Morning Benders</a> are afraid of doing a cover version or two.  Though they&#8217;d just released their second album <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?from=90804&#038;p=INS43559" target="new" title="Talking Through Tin Cans"><i>Talking Through Tin Cans</i></a> in May of last year, they still found the time to put together an album&#8217;s worth of covers a couple months later, which they released for free download as <a href="http://ambenders.blogspot.com/2008/07/bedroom-covers.html" target="new" title="Bedroom Covers"><i>The Bedroom Covers</i></a> (still available to grab!).</p>
<p>One of the selections on the compilation was &#8220;Lovefool&#8221;, the song which both acted as a worldwide breakout hit for Sweden&#8217;s <a href="Http://www.cardigans.com" target="new" title="Cardigans">Cardigans</a> back in 1997 and lightly damned the band as a one-hit wonder to those who couldn&#8217;t perceive the deliciously dark undercurrent that ran through both that song and really, their entire oeuvre.  And watching the two videos the band made for the song, I have to wonder if that would have happened had they released the rather sexy and very European version over here rather than the cutesy one with Nina Persson batting her ridiculously blue eyes?  Persson will release her second album with <a href="http://www.acamp.net" title="A CAmp">A Camp</a>, <i>Colonia</i>, in Europe this Monday and in North America on April 28.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/interface/20081121aCamp.jpg" title="A Camp" class="leftImgWithCredit" /><span class="leftCreditWide"><img src="Http://www.chromewaves.net/images/icon_cam.gif" class="cam" alt="Photo via MySpace" /><a href="http://www.myspace.com/acamptheband" target="new" title="A Camp">MySpace</a></span>Just yesterday morning I was listening to <a href="Http://www.cardigans.com" target="new" title="Cardigans">The Cardigans&#8217;</a> wonderful and underappreciated <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?pfrom=90804&#038;=INS22910" target="new" title="Long Gone Before Daylight"><i>Long Gone Before Daylight</i></a>, and it occurred to me that I hadn&#8217;t heard any news about the new record from <a href="http://www.acamp.net/" target="new" title="A Camp">A Camp</a>, Nina Persson&#8217;s solo project, in a while.  Cue <a href="http://www.nme.com/news/the-cardigans/41184" target="new" title="NME vs A Camp"><i>NME</i></a>, who yesterday reported that said record &#8211; <i>Colonia</i> &#8211; will see the light of day on February 2 in the UK and Europe.  Not sure if there&#8217;s a North American schedule on the books yet, though.</p>
<p>Don&#8217;t know if the background music at their website is any indication of the direction of the record, but there&#8217;s also a <a href="http://www.acamp.net/atwork/index.html" target="new" title="A Camp at work">photo gallery</a> of the band in the studio to whet one&#8217;s appetite.  I had heard that they wouldn&#8217;t necessarily be continuing the alt.country vibe that made the now eight-year old (!) A Camp debut so delicious &#8211; <a href="http://www.sparklehorse.com" target="new" title="Sparklehorse">Mark Linkous</a> isn&#8217;t driving things this time &#8211; and while that&#8217;s sort of a shame, the fact that there&#8217;s a new record coming from Persson, Cardies or otherwise, is good news any way you look at it.  Core collaborators on the record are Niclas Frisk and Persson&#8217;s husband/<a href="http://www.shuddertothink.com/" target="new" title="STT">Shudder To Think</a> guitarist Nathan Larson and there are guest spots from <a href="http://www.myspace.com/jamesiha" target="new" title="James Iha">James Iha</a> and <a href="http://www.joanaspolicewoman.com/" target="new" title="Joan Wasser">Joan Wasser</a>, amongst others.  And the album cover looks <a href="http://cdon.se/media-dynamic/images/product/00/04/05/75/36/3/47c676b5-5c4f-4b08-bece-795617981b81.jpg" target="new" title="Colonia">like this</a>. <p>Following up on last year&#8217;s <a href="http://www.insound.com/search/showrelease.jsp?pfrom=90804&#038;=INS37411" target="new" title="GBA"><i>Guilt By Association</i></a> covers compilation featuring the likes of <a href="Http://www.superchunk.com" target="new" title="Superchunk">Superchunk</a>, <a href="http://www.fuzzywuzzy.com" target="new" title="Luna">Luna</a> and <a href="http://www.theconcretes.com/" Target="new" title="Concretes">The Concretes</a> covering songs they deemed to be guilty pleasures, <a href="http://www.pitchforkmedia.com/article/news/147562-my-brightest-diamond-frightened-rabbit-do-covers" target="new" title="PF vs GBA">Pitchfork</a> has details on the sequel.  Volume two doesn&#8217;t have quite the star power of the first and its mandate is shifted slightly to encompass Top 40 pop from the &#8217;80s through today (guilty pleasure or not), and as such you&#8217;ve got the likes of <a href="http://www.myspace.com/frightenedrabbit" target="new" title="FR">Frightened Rabbit</a>, <a href="http://www.mybrightestdiamond.com/" target="new" title="MBD">My Brightest Diamond</a> and <a href="Http://www.mattpondpa.com" target="new" title="MPPA">Matt Pond PA</a> amongst the coverers and <a href="http://www.toto99.com/" Target="new" title="toto">Toto</a>, <a href="http://www.billyjoel.com/" Target="new" title="Billy Joel">Billy Joel</a> and <a href="http://www.katyperry.com/" Target="new" title="Katy Perry">Katy Perry</a> amongst the coverees.  Though the CD isn&#8217;t out until February 17 of next year, you can stream it below and it&#8217;s already available digitally from the likes of <a href="http://www.emusic.com/album/Various-Artists-Guilt-By-Association-Vol-2-MP3-Download/11316830.html" target="new" title="GBA @ eMusic">eMusic</a>.  A third volume is also already in the works.
